package license
import (
"os"
"testing"
"time"
)
// init sets dev mode for tests so license validation works without a real public key
func init() {
os.Setenv("PULSE_LICENSE_DEV_MODE", "true")
}
func TestTierHasFeature(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
tier Tier
feature string
expected bool
}{
{"free has no AI patrol", TierFree, FeatureAIPatrol, false},
{"pro has AI patrol", TierPro, FeatureAIPatrol, true},
{"pro has AI alerts", TierPro, FeatureAIAlerts, true},
{"pro has AI autofix", TierPro, FeatureAIAutoFix, true},
{"pro has K8s AI", TierPro, FeatureKubernetesAI, true},
{"pro does not have multi-user", TierPro, FeatureMultiUser, false},
{"lifetime has AI patrol", TierLifetime, FeatureAIPatrol, true},
{"msp has unlimited", TierMSP, FeatureUnlimited, true},
{"msp does not have multi-user yet", TierMSP, FeatureMultiUser, false},
{"enterprise has multi-user", TierEnterprise, FeatureMultiUser, true},
{"enterprise has white-label", TierEnterprise, FeatureWhiteLabel, true},
{"unknown tier has nothing", Tier("unknown"), FeatureAIPatrol, false},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
result := TierHasFeature(tt.tier, tt.feature)
if result != tt.expected {
t.Errorf("TierHasFeature(%v, %v) = %v, want %v",
tt.tier, tt.feature, result, tt.expected)
}
})
}
}
func TestLicenseHasFeature(t *testing.T) {
license := &License{
Claims: Claims{
Tier: TierPro,
Features: []string{"custom_feature"},
},
}
// Should have tier features
if !license.HasFeature(FeatureAIPatrol) {
t.Error("Pro license should have AI Patrol")
}
// Should have explicit features
if !license.HasFeature("custom_feature") {
t.Error("License should have explicitly granted feature")
}
// Should not have ungranted features
if license.HasFeature(FeatureMultiUser) {
t.Error("Pro license should not have multi-user")
}
}
func TestLicenseExpiration(t *testing.T) {
t.Run("lifetime license never expires", func(t *testing.T) {
license := &License{
Claims: Claims{
Tier: TierLifetime,
ExpiresAt: 0,
},
}
if license.IsExpired() {
t.Error("Lifetime license should not be expired")
}
if !license.IsLifetime() {
t.Error("Should be detected as lifetime")
}
if license.DaysRemaining() != -1 {
t.Error("Lifetime should return -1 days remaining")
}
})
t.Run("expired license", func(t *testing.T) {
license := &License{
Claims: Claims{
Tier: TierPro,
ExpiresAt: time.Now().Add(-24 * time.Hour).Unix(),
},
}
if !license.IsExpired() {
t.Error("License should be expired")
}
if license.DaysRemaining() != 0 {
t.Error("Expired license should return 0 days remaining")
}
})
t.Run("valid license", func(t *testing.T) {
license := &License{
Claims: Claims{
Tier: TierPro,
ExpiresAt: time.Now().Add(30 * 24 * time.Hour).Unix(),
},
}
if license.IsExpired() {
t.Error("License should not be expired")
}
remaining := license.DaysRemaining()
if remaining < 29 || remaining > 30 {
t.Errorf("Expected ~30 days remaining, got %d", remaining)
}
})
t.Run("grace period license", func(t *testing.T) {
// Create a license that expired 3 days ago (within 7-day grace period)
expiredAt := time.Now().Add(-3 * 24 * time.Hour).Unix()
testKey, _ := GenerateLicenseForTesting("test@example.com", TierPro, 0)
// Manually create claims with expired time for testing
claims := Claims{
LicenseID: "test_grace",
Email: "grace@example.com",
Tier: TierPro,
IssuedAt: time.Now().Add(-33 * 24 * time.Hour).Unix(),
ExpiresAt: expiredAt,
}
license := &License{
Raw: testKey,
Claims: claims,
}
// License is technically expired
if !license.IsExpired() {
t.Error("License should be expired")
}
// But with grace period set, it should still work
gracePeriodEnd := time.Now().Add(4 * 24 * time.Hour)
license.GracePeriodEnd = &gracePeriodEnd
// Service should recognize grace period
service := NewService()
service.mu.Lock()
service.license = license
service.mu.Unlock()
// Should still have features during grace period
if !service.HasFeature(FeatureAIPatrol) {
t.Error("Should have feature during grace period")
}
if !service.IsValid() {
t.Error("Should be valid during grace period")
}
// Status should show grace period
status := service.Status()
if !status.InGracePeriod {
t.Error("Status should show in grace period")
}
})
}
func TestServiceFeatureGating(t *testing.T) {
service := NewService()
// No license - should not have features
if service.HasFeature(FeatureAIPatrol) {
t.Error("Should not have feature without license")
}
if service.IsValid() {
t.Error("Should not be valid without license")
}
// Activate test license
testKey, err := GenerateLicenseForTesting("test@example.com", TierPro, 30*24*time.Hour)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Failed to generate test license: %v", err)
}
// Clear public key for testing (since test licenses have fake signatures)
SetPublicKey(nil)
license, err := service.Activate(testKey)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Failed to activate test license: %v", err)
}
if license.Claims.Email != "test@example.com" {
t.Error("Email mismatch")
}
if license.Claims.Tier != TierPro {
t.Error("Tier mismatch")
}
// Should now have Pro features
if !service.HasFeature(FeatureAIPatrol) {
t.Error("Should have AI Patrol with Pro license")
}
if !service.IsValid() {
t.Error("Should be valid with active license")
}
// Require feature should succeed
if err := service.RequireFeature(FeatureAIPatrol); err != nil {
t.Errorf("RequireFeature should succeed: %v", err)
}
// Require feature should fail for ungranted feature
if err := service.RequireFeature(FeatureMultiUser); err == nil {
t.Error("RequireFeature should fail for multi-user")
}
// Clear license
service.Clear()
if service.IsValid() {
t.Error("Should not be valid after clearing")
}
}
func TestValidateLicenseMalformed(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
licenseKey string
}{
{"empty", ""},
{"not jwt", "not-a-jwt"},
{"two parts", "part1.part2"},
{"bad base64 header", "!!!.part2.part3"},
{"bad base64 payload", "eyJhbGciOiJFZERTQSJ9.!!!.part3"},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
_, err := ValidateLicense(tt.licenseKey)
if err == nil {
t.Error("Expected error for malformed license")
}
})
}
}
func TestLicenseStatus(t *testing.T) {
service := NewService()
// Status with no license
status := service.Status()
if status.Valid {
t.Error("Should not be valid")
}
if status.Tier != TierFree {
t.Errorf("Expected free tier, got %v", status.Tier)
}
// Activate license
SetPublicKey(nil) // Skip signature check for testing
testKey, _ := GenerateLicenseForTesting("test@example.com", TierLifetime, 0)
_, _ = service.Activate(testKey)
status = service.Status()
if !status.Valid {
t.Error("Should be valid")
}
if status.Tier != TierLifetime {
t.Errorf("Expected lifetime tier, got %v", status.Tier)
}
if !status.IsLifetime {
t.Error("Should be detected as lifetime")
}
if status.DaysRemaining != -1 {
t.Errorf("Expected -1 days remaining, got %d", status.DaysRemaining)
}
if len(status.Features) == 0 {
t.Error("Should have features")
}
}
func TestGetTierDisplayName(t *testing.T) {
if GetTierDisplayName(TierPro) != "Pro (Monthly)" {
t.Error("Wrong display name for Pro")
}
if GetTierDisplayName(TierLifetime) != "Pro (Lifetime)" {
t.Error("Wrong display name for Lifetime")
}
}
func TestGetFeatureDisplayName(t *testing.T) {
if GetFeatureDisplayName(FeatureAIPatrol) != "AI Patrol (Background Health Checks)" {
t.Error("Wrong display name for AI Patrol")
}
}
func TestPublicKeyRequiredWithoutDevMode(t *testing.T) {
// This test verifies that without PULSE_LICENSE_DEV_MODE=true,
// license validation fails when no public key is set.
// The test itself runs with PULSE_LICENSE_DEV_MODE=true (set in go test env),
// so we just check that ValidateLicense returns ErrNoPublicKey when appropriate.
// Save current public key state
originalKey := publicKey
defer SetPublicKey(originalKey)
// Clear public key
SetPublicKey(nil)
// Generate a test license
testKey, err := GenerateLicenseForTesting("test@example.com", TierPro, 30*24*time.Hour)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Failed to generate test license: %v", err)
}
// In dev mode (set via env), this should succeed
// In production (no dev mode), this would fail with ErrNoPublicKey
// We test that the license CAN be validated in dev mode
_, err = ValidateLicense(testKey)
if err != nil {
// If running without PULSE_LICENSE_DEV_MODE=true, we expect this error
if err.Error() != "no public key configured for validation: signature verification required" {
t.Logf("License validation in dev mode: %v", err)
}
}
}
func TestStatusSetsGracePeriodDynamically(t *testing.T) {
// Test that Status() dynamically sets GracePeriodEnd when license expires
// without requiring HasFeature() to be called first
service := NewService()
// Create a license that expired 3 days ago (within 7-day grace)
expiredAt := time.Now().Add(-3 * 24 * time.Hour)
lic := &License{
Claims: Claims{
LicenseID: "test_status_grace",
Email: "test@example.com",
Tier: TierPro,
IssuedAt: time.Now().Add(-33 * 24 * time.Hour).Unix(),
ExpiresAt: expiredAt.Unix(),
},
ValidatedAt: time.Now().Add(-33 * 24 * time.Hour),
// Note: GracePeriodEnd is NOT set - simulating runtime expiration
}
// Manually set the license without grace period
service.mu.Lock()
service.license = lic
service.mu.Unlock()
// Verify GracePeriodEnd is nil initially
if lic.GracePeriodEnd != nil {
t.Fatal("GracePeriodEnd should be nil initially")
}
// Call Status() - this should set GracePeriodEnd dynamically
status := service.Status()
// Verify Status() set the grace period
if lic.GracePeriodEnd == nil {
t.Fatal("Status() should have set GracePeriodEnd")
}
// Status should show as valid during grace period
if !status.Valid {
t.Error("Status should be valid during grace period")
}
if !status.InGracePeriod {
t.Error("Status should show in grace period")
}
if status.GracePeriodEnd == nil {
t.Error("Status should include GracePeriodEnd")
}
// Verify HasFeature also works during grace
if !service.HasFeature(FeatureAIPatrol) {
t.Error("HasFeature should return true during grace period")
}
}
